Output 606abde0dd9762d3688e19ec58cf67d19a0c2491e8517b04d034cfdd726fdf88:19

value
2809424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d29616b7087424d59108a52daa52e6ed4c11252 OP_EQUAL
address
3EZQmmBWCwe4Z6AbRw1K3GmG6BU2n61EjB
transaction
606abde0dd9762d3688e19ec58cf67d19a0c2491e8517b04d034cfdd726fdf88
spent
true